Description
【発明の詳細な説明】 〔産業上の利用分野〕 表面に凹凸模様を有する木質繊維からなる塗装を施され
た化粧板及び製造方法に関する。Description: [Industrial field of application] The present invention relates to a decorative board coated with a wood fiber having an uneven pattern on its surface and a manufacturing method.
木質繊維からなる塗装を施された化粧板としては次のよ
うな提案がなされている。The following proposals have been made for a decorative board coated with wood fibers.
イ 特公昭40−14990号のように物品面凹凸模様を形成
しこの模様面に透明性塗料を全面的に塗布し、塗料中の
顔料を模様の凹部に沈降させ、模様の凸部には透明層の
みが形成せられるようにしたもの。B. As shown in Japanese Examined Patent Publication No. 40-14990, an uneven surface pattern is formed on the article, and a transparent paint is applied to the entire surface of the pattern. The pigment in the paint is allowed to settle in the concave part of the pattern, and the convex part of the pattern is transparent. It is designed so that only layers can be formed.
この提案では模様の凸部には物品他色が透明層を介して
表現され凹部には塗料中の顔料が沈降され着色がなされ
るが色彩的には単色であり意匠性が単調だという難点が
ある。In this proposal, the convex portion of the pattern expresses the other color of the article through the transparent layer and the concave portion is colored by the sedimentation of the pigment in the paint, but the color is monochromatic and the design is monotonous. is there.
ロ また本出願人の出願にかかる実公昭50−10475号の
ように、 「木質繊維からなる基材の凸状外面にシーラー塗膜層を
層着しその表面および凹状外面へ不透明塗装膜を層着し
て均一な色調となし不透明塗膜層表面へ凹状面における
半透明塗膜層の塗膜厚を凸状面よりも厚く層着して構成
された凹凸模様を有する塗装ボード」 も提案されている。In addition, as in Japanese Utility Model Publication No. 50-10475 filed by the present applicant, “A sealer coating layer is layered on the convex outer surface of a substrate made of wood fiber, and an opaque coating film is formed on the surface and the concave outer surface. It is also proposed that "a coated board having an uneven pattern formed by layering the coating thickness of the semitransparent coating layer on the concave surface to be thicker than that on the convex surface" ing.
この提案は比重の低い凸状外面にシーラー塗膜層を形成
し、その表面へ塗装される着色塗料の吸い込みを防止
し、もって凹凸状外面の表面密度に関係なく均一な着色
塗膜層を形成した後に半透明塗膜層を塗布することによ
り、 半透明塗膜層が不透明塗膜層表面へ凸状外面部が導く凹
状外面部が厚くなるように層着されている。したがっ
て、凸状面においては薄い半透明塗膜層を透して不透明
塗膜層の色調が強調表現され、凹状面では不透明塗膜の
色調が半透明塗膜層でほぼ隠蔽されて半透明塗膜層によ
る色調が強調表現される。This proposal forms a sealer coating layer on the convex outer surface with a low specific gravity to prevent the absorption of the colored paint applied to the surface, thus forming a uniform colored coating layer regardless of the surface density of the uneven outer surface. After that, the semitransparent coating layer is applied so that the semitransparent coating layer is layered so that the concave outer surface portion where the convex outer surface portion leads to the opaque coating layer surface becomes thick. Therefore, on the convex surface, the color tone of the opaque coating layer is emphasized through the thin semi-transparent coating layer, and on the concave surface, the color tone of the opaque coating layer is almost hidden by the semi-transparent coating layer. The color tone of the film layer is emphasized.
また凸状面から凹状面への中間部においても凹部の深さ
に応じて半透明塗膜層も厚くなる如く構成されるので凸
状面と凹状面との色調の変化も同一塗料の濃淡差で断層
がなく自然な色の変化を生じせしめる。Further, even in the intermediate portion from the convex surface to the concave surface, the semi-transparent coating layer is configured to be thicker according to the depth of the concave portion, so that the change in color tone between the convex surface and the concave surface is the same as the difference in shade of the same paint. There is no fault, and it causes a natural color change.
しかし意匠的に向上されたものの着色塗膜層半透明塗膜
層の2層を構成しなくてはならず生産ラインが煩雑とな
り、 また同一塗料の濃淡差であり、変化に乏しいという問題
点を残している。However, although it has been improved in design, it is necessary to form two layers of a colored coating layer and a semi-transparent coating layer, which complicates the production line, and the difference in shade of the same coating causes little change. I have left.
(問題を解決するための手段とその作用) 本発明は上記問題点を解決するため次のような構成をと
ったものである。すなわち木質繊維からなる化粧板を塗
装するとき、 まづ表面密度の緻密な凹部と、密度の粗な凸部3とから
なる凹凸模様を形成し、 凹凸模様の形成された表全面に比重が高く粒子の大きな
大粒子高比重顔料4aと、粒子の大きな顔料4aと色調が異
なり、かつ該顔料4aより比重が低く、粒子の小さな小粒
子低比重顔料4bとを任意混合された着色塗料4を塗布
し、凹部2にその表面に大粒子高比重顔料4aが沈降し、
小粒子低比重顔料4bがその上部に層をなした凹部塗膜層
Aと、凸部3に基材1内に、小粒子低比重顔料4bが浸透
され、かつ、表面に大粒子高比重顔料4aが層をなした凸
部塗膜層Bをそれぞれ形成するものである。(Means for Solving Problems and Actions Thereof) The present invention has the following configuration in order to solve the above problems. That is, when a decorative board made of wood fiber is applied, a concavo-convex pattern consisting of concave parts having a high surface density and convex parts 3 having a coarse density is formed first, and the specific gravity is high on the entire surface on which the concavo-convex pattern is formed. Applying a colored paint 4 in which a large particle high specific gravity pigment 4a having a large particle size, a large particle large pigment 4a having a different color tone, and a specific gravity lower than that of the pigment 4a, and a small particle low particle specific gravity pigment 4b having a small particle size are arbitrarily mixed. Then, the large particle high specific gravity pigment 4a settles on the surface of the concave portion 2,
The small particle low specific gravity pigment 4b is formed on the upper surface of the concave coating film layer A, and the convex portion 3 is penetrated into the substrate 1 by the small particle low specific gravity pigment 4b, and the large particle high specific gravity pigment is formed on the surface. 4a forms each of the convex coating film layers B forming a layer.
本発明は上記の構成を採用することにより、凹凸模様部
2,3において色の異なる着色塗膜層A,Bが一回の塗装工程
で得られるようにしたものである。すなわち意匠性の高
い塗膜層が単純な工程で得られるものである。The present invention, by adopting the above-mentioned configuration, has an uneven pattern portion.
In 2 and 3, colored coating layers A and B having different colors can be obtained in a single coating step. That is, a coating layer having a high design property can be obtained by a simple process.
以下本発明の実施例について説明する。Examples of the present invention will be described below.
(実施例の説明) 第1〜3図に本発明第1実施例を示す。(Description of Embodiments) FIGS. 1 to 3 show a first embodiment of the present invention.
第1〜3図において、 基材1は通常の方法により得られる木質繊維を圧締成形
して製造されるファイバーボードである。1 to 3, the base material 1 is a fiber board produced by compression molding wood fibers obtained by a usual method.
ファイバーボードにかえて塗料の吸い込みが大きくなさ
れる基材であれば特に限定されるものではない。The base material is not particularly limited as long as it is a base material that can absorb the paint instead of the fiber board.
まづ、第1図のように基材1表面に凹凸模様をエンボス
ロール、エンボスプレートなどにより形成する。その際
エンボス装置の押圧により、凹部2は密度が緻密にな
り、凸部3は逆に粗になる。First, as shown in FIG. 1, an uneven pattern is formed on the surface of the substrate 1 by an embossing roll, an embossing plate, or the like. At that time, due to the pressing of the embossing device, the concave portions 2 become dense and the convex portions 3 become rough.
つぎに、第2図のように凹凸模様の形成された表全面に
比重が高く粒子の大きな大粒子高比重顔料4aと、大粒子
高比重顔料4aと色調が異なり、かつ該顔料4aより比重が
低く粒子の小さい小粒子低比重顔料4bとを任意混合され
た着色塗料4を塗装装置を用いてほぼ均一に塗布する。Next, as shown in FIG. 2, a large particle high specific gravity pigment 4a having a high specific gravity and large particles on the entire surface on which an uneven pattern is formed and a large particle high specific gravity pigment 4a have different color tones, and a specific gravity higher than that of the pigment 4a. A colored paint 4 optionally mixed with small particles and small particles and low specific gravity pigment 4b is applied almost uniformly using a coating device.
そして、しばらく放置しておくと着色塗料4は凹部2に
おいては基材1の密度が緻密なため、基材1内へ吸い込
まれることなく第3図のように凹部塗膜層Aを形成す
る。Then, when left for a while, the colored coating material 4 forms the recess coating layer A as shown in FIG. 3 without being sucked into the base 1 because the density of the base 1 in the recess 2 is high.
凹部着色塗装膜Aは着色塗料4中に大粒子高比重顔料4a
と小粒子低比重顔料4bが混合されているため大粒子高比
重顔料4aは沈降し、 逆に小粒子低比重顔料4bはその上部に層をなすように構
成される。The concave portion colored coating film A has a large particle high specific gravity pigment 4a in the colored coating material 4.
Since the small particle low specific gravity pigment 4b is mixed with the large particle high specific gravity pigment 4a, the small particle low specific gravity pigment 4b is configured so that the small particle low specific gravity pigment 4b forms a layer on the upper part thereof.
そのために凹部2の凹部塗膜層Aは塗膜厚が厚く小粒子
低比重顔料4bの色調が濃く表現される。Therefore, the coating film layer A of the concave portion 2 has a thick coating film and the small particle low specific gravity pigment 4b is expressed in a deep color tone.
小粒子低比重顔料4bの添加量を変化させることによって
例えば減少していくことで低比重顔料4bを含む上層の色
調を透し、塗膜層A低部に沈降する大粒子高比重顔料4a
の色調が影響して現出され微妙な色変化が得られる。By changing the addition amount of the small particle low specific gravity pigment 4b, for example, by decreasing it, the color tone of the upper layer containing the low specific gravity pigment 4b is transmitted, and the large particle high specific gravity pigment 4a that settles in the lower portion of the coating layer A
The subtle color change is obtained due to the effect of the color tone of.
凸部3内においては、着色塗料4は、凸部3の密度が粗
であるため、その一部が基材1内に吸い込まれ凸部塗膜
層Bを形成する。In the convex portion 3, the coloring paint 4 has a rough density of the convex portion 3, and therefore a part thereof is sucked into the base material 1 to form the convex coating film layer B.
凸部着色塗膜層Bは着色塗料4中に大粒子高比重顔料4a
と、小粒子低比重顔料4bとが混合されているために該塗
料4の基材1内への吸い込みに伴なう流動に誘因され、
粒子の小さい小粒子低比重顔料4bが塗料4と一緒に基材
1内に吸い込まれ比重が高く粒子の大きな大粒子高比重
顔料4aが凸部3内に多く残置され層をなすように構成さ
れる。The convex colored coating layer B is a large particle high specific gravity pigment 4a in the colored paint 4.
And the small particle low specific gravity pigment 4b are mixed with each other, so that the paint 4 is attracted to the flow accompanied with the suction into the base material 1,
A small particle small particle low specific gravity pigment 4b is sucked into the substrate 1 together with the coating material 4 and a large particle large particle high specific gravity pigment 4a having a large particle size is left in the convex portion 3 to form a layer. It
そのために凸部3の凸部着色塗膜層Bは塗膜厚は若干薄
くなり粒子の大きな高比重顔料4aの色調が濃く表現され
る。Therefore, the coating film thickness of the convex coating film layer B of the convex portion 3 is slightly thin, and the color tone of the high specific gravity pigment 4a having large particles is expressed deeply.
小粒子低比重顔料4bあるいは大粒子高比重顔料4aの添加
量を変化させることによって凸部3内の塗膜層B中に残
置する小粒子低比重顔料4bの割合が変化し、異なる色調
が顔料4a,4bの色調が影響し現出され微妙な色変化が得
られる。この色変化は大粒子高比重顔料4aの添加量を変
化させることによっても得られるものである。凹部2に
凹部塗膜層A、凸部3に凸部塗膜層Bの形成された基材
1の表全面に必要に応じて上塗り塗装を施しても何等差
し支えない。By changing the addition amount of the small particle low specific gravity pigment 4b or the large particle high specific gravity pigment 4a, the proportion of the small particle low specific gravity pigment 4b remaining in the coating layer B in the convex portion 3 changes, and a different color tone is obtained. The color tones of 4a and 4b influence and appear, and a subtle color change is obtained. This color change can also be obtained by changing the addition amount of the large particle high specific gravity pigment 4a. If necessary, top coating may be applied to the entire front surface of the substrate 1 on which the concave coating layer A is formed on the concave portion 2 and the convex coating layer B is formed on the convex portion 3.
そして大粒子高比重顔料4aと小粒子低比重顔料4bとの色
を変えてあるので凹凸部2,3の色を変えることができ、
意匠性の向上に役立つ。And since the colors of the large particle high specific gravity pigment 4a and the small particle low specific gravity pigment 4b are changed, the colors of the uneven portions 2 and 3 can be changed,
Useful for improving the design.
大粒子高比重顔料4aと、小粒子低比重顔料4bとを混合し
た着色塗料を用いて基材への該塗料の吸い込み差により
表面凹凸模様の凸模様部と凹模様部との色変化が出き、
かつ1回の着色塗装で行なえる。また各顔料4a,4bの添
加量を変えることで容易に色変化を微妙になし得る。By using a colored paint in which a large particle high specific gravity pigment 4a and a small particle low specific gravity pigment 4b are mixed, the color difference between the convex and concave portions of the surface unevenness pattern appears due to the difference in the absorption of the coating material into the substrate. The
And it can be done with one color painting. Further, the color change can be easily made subtly by changing the addition amount of each pigment 4a, 4b.
